In Arusha, Tanzania, a telecom company replaced three stand-alone cell towers' diesel generators with 10 kW solar containers. The cost of the initial investment was $39,000 per unit. It took 26 months for the system to pay for itself through saved diesel costs and reduced outages. The icing on the. .
